WebMost types of fish, especially larger species, contain mercury. Mercury can be toxic in high amounts, so it is best to avoid consuming too much. However, cod is not high in mercury. WebHow to Avoid too Much Mercury. The first trick you can master to identify less mercury fish is observing the size. Smaller fish contain less mercury compared to predator fish. Further, the longer the fish’s lifespan, the more mercury level it has in its tissues. Secondly, lower your fish consumption to at least once or twice a week. WebFeb 25, 2016 · Be sure to avoid fish that are commonly high in mercury, which include tilefish from the Gulf of Mexico, shark, swordfish and king mackerel, according to the FDA.
